The £165-an-hour trainer knocking Boris into shape

- By Claire Ellicott Political Correspond­ent

THE Prime Minister has hired a £ 165- an- hour celebrity personal trainer to help him lose weight after his close call with coronaviru­s.

Boris Johnson was spotted running with fitness coach Harry Jameson near Westminste­r yesterday looking out of breath.

It comes after he pledged to get the nation to lose weight after being in intensive care with the virus earlier this year.

A No10 source said: ‘It’s because he is really serious about getting fit, as anyone who has seen him over the past couple of months knows, Boris is raring to go.’

The Prime Minister has blamed being overweight for the severity of his illness when he contracted coronaviru­s in March.

He was also forced to deny claims that he might quit his job in six months because of the toll the disease had taken on him. The claim was reportedly made by Sir Humphry Wakefield, the father-inlaw of his close aide Dominic Cummings.

He is said to have told a holidaymak­er who visited his castle in Northumber­land that Mr Johnson is still suffering longer-term ill effects of coronaviru­s and could resign, according to The Times.

But Mr Johnson said: ‘It’s absolute nonsense. I am feeling, if anything, far better as I’ve lost some weight.’ Mr Jameson is a London-based personal trainer who describes himself as an ‘elite performanc­e coach’ and boasts a roster of famous clients.

No10 last night refused to say whether Mr Johnson was paying for the trainer’s services, or if they were compliment­ary.
